Vincent B. Bedoy, age 86, of Highland, passed away Sunday, July 31, 2022. He is survived by his children; Elizabeth (Adel) Al-Akel, Jennifer (Steve)Borkowski, Allison (Thomas)Geiger, and Vincent J.J. Bedoy. Eleven grandchildren; Jessica, George, Sarah, Jordan, Jeromy, Joshua, Paige, Zachary, Mychaela, Selena, and Sam. Four great-grandchildren, Charlotte, Aleksandar, Sophia, and Carlos. Many nieces and nephews, and his caregiver/fiancé, Yolanda Cordero. He is preceded in death by his Loving Wife, Nelle Bedoy of 54 years, Son, Timothy Bedoy, parents, Jose Jesus and Luz Bedoy, and siblings, Alfred Avina, Rudy Avina, and Sally Campos Carey.
Vincent graduated from Bishop Noll Institute, Class of 1955, was a Veteran of the U.S. Army, and worked for Inland Steel for 43 years as an Electrician and Rigger. He served as a Union Steward for the Local 1010 for many years. He was a good provider to his family and had a great work ethic. He enjoyed spending time with his family, especially holidays, birthdays and family dinners and he loved Nelle’s cooking...she could cook anything magnificently! Our Dad loved road trips, visiting family and just vacationing to new places. We traveled all over the states. He liked to get in the car and just drive! He was “Mr. Twinkle Toes”...A Big Guy like that could dance...how he enjoyed dancing. He could fix anything. He once said “if you have the right tools ... you could fix anything, otherwise improvise”. Dad was definitely a sports fan. He could watch sports all day! He enjoyed basketball and football, especially the “Packers”. He enjoyed bantering about whose team would win the games and wager fun little bets with his children and grandchildren. He was a basketball coach at Bishop Noll and Our Lady of Grace many years ago. He enjoyed meeting family and friends for breakfast and dinners and trying new restaurants.
